No. If you don't see or hear it, you should never know it is there. These indicators are an incredibly lame mechanic in pretty much every game that has it. It's fine in singleplayer campaigns, but has no business being in multiplayer.
There is a pretty clear visual and auditory cue when a grenade is nearby. You can both see someone preparing to throw a grenade (They hunch over and no longer appear to be holding a gun) and there is a pretty loud beep associated with throwing it. They also clink a bit when they bounce on most surfaces. There is a thing called situational awareness. If you don't have it in a shooter, you're going to die. A lot.
